French International School of Bahrain

The French International School of Bahrain (French: Lycée français MLF de Bahrein, Arabic: المدرسة الفرنسية في البحرين) is an international French educational institution in Muharraq, Bahrain. Established in 1976, the school has been managed by the International Network for French Education (French: Mission Laïque français) abroad since 2008.

Overview

International French School of Bahrain is a school accredited by the French Ministry of Education. Academic levels start from kindergarten to grade 12 (high school). The school follows the same programs as public schools in France, and the graduation certificate is issued by the French Ministry of Education. The French school in Bahrain focuses on language education, where French, English and Arabic are taught from kindergarten to high school. Starting from Grade 7, Spanish is taught as a fourth language, and it is a mandatory subject until grade 12 (high school).
